#d7bdfc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7bdfc is composed of 84.3% red, 74.1%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.7% cyan, 25%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 264.8 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 86.5%. #d7bdfc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#af7bf9.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

● #d7bdfc color description : Very soft violet.
#d7bdfc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7bdfc has RGB values of R:215, G:189,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 14138876.

Shades and Tints of #d7bdfc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040009 is the darkest color, while #f9f5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d7bdfc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dcdadf is the less saturated color, while #d7baff is the most saturated one.
